Output ec24bd6a822e3af7bd448dee033ca824262fac4cc89ef2e1081b9f58030cfe35:7

value
3720767338
script pubkey
OP_0 OP_PUSHBYTES_32 31d8836a324be070a2e2aa020c87164c7224a58e2e8bf73e1c59074ad197d1be
address
bc1qx8vgx63jf0s8pghz4gpqepckf3ezffvw969lw0sutyr545vh6xlqeqllrm
transaction
ec24bd6a822e3af7bd448dee033ca824262fac4cc89ef2e1081b9f58030cfe35
spent
true